The Wombats Tickets

The Wombats rolled out and into the UK's musical scene at the start of 2003. The band's angsty lyrics and poppy melodies were the perfect combination for young teens across England, making them a sensation within five years. The band's music is surprisingly upbeat and creates an almost ironic background to the otherwise sardonic content of its songs. The band's second album,

This Modern Glitch

, was released seven years after the band's debut, and it has since solidified them as a band with substantial fan backing. In spite of its commercial success, The Wombats have been known to frequent smaller venues and clubs around the world in addition to performing at renowned festivals like the

Austin City Limits

in Austin, Texas.

Just Give Me a Try

Dan Haggis, Tord Øverland Knudsen and Matthew Murphy met while studying at the Liverpool Institute of Performing Arts. They quickly bonded over their love of music and their desire to make it big. The trio began touring around the UK and eventually took to international stages over the next five years with the band's sophomore album,

This Modern Glitch

, appearing on the top charts in the UK. More recently, the band's music has made it to the

Billboard

Top 200. In the band's relatively short career, The Wombats have appeared on late-night shows, its music has been featured in commercials for airlines and the band has enjoyed serious touring success.

Which of The Wombats albums are considered essential?

This Modern Glitch

is the album that really put the band on the map back in 2010. This earlier album packs a serious punch by featuring some of the band's catchier hits like Tokyo (Vampires & Wolves).

Glitterbug

is also a must-listen album that features songs of a similar nature, but with more refined musical backing. It was also the band's first album to make it to the charts in the US.

What are some of the songs The Wombats perform at its shows?

When touring, The Wombats tend to be promoting the band's most recent album, so you can expect to hear a number of newer singles sprinkled throughout any given show. In addition, the band always plays a few of its hits. Moving to New York, Jump Into the Fog, Techno Fan, Let's Dance to Joy Division, Just Give Me a Try and Turn are all hits that you can expect to hear either during the show itself or during the encore.

Have The Wombats been nominated for any awards?

The Wombats has been nominated for three NME awards, one of which the band won in 2008 for Best Dancefloor Filler. The band was also nominated for Best Album at the XFM New Music Awards and Best UK and Ireland New Act at the 2008 MTV Europe Music Awards.
